Birth charts, also known as natal charts, are astrological maps of the sky at the time of your birth. They are used to gain insights into personality, life events, and potential. But did you know that Comparing Birth Charts can offer a deeper understanding of relationships and compatibility with others? This practice, often used in astrology, can illuminate the dynamics between individuals, whether in romantic partnerships, friendships, or family bonds.
Comparing birth charts, sometimes referred to as synastry, is a fascinating technique that overlays two individual birth charts to identify areas of harmony and tension. By examining the planetary placements and aspects between two charts, astrologers can analyze the potential for understanding, growth, and challenges within a relationship. This method goes beyond simple sun sign compatibility, delving into the complexities of individual personalities and how they interact.
There are several approaches to comparing birth charts. Synastry is the most common, focusing on the aspects formed between planets in each chart. For example, if one person’s Mars is conjunct another person’s Venus, this can indicate strong attraction and passion. Composite charts are another technique, creating a new chart based on the midpoint between two individuals’ planets. This composite chart represents the relationship itself as a separate entity, revealing the overall energy and potential of the union.
When comparing birth charts, astrologers look for various indicators. Harmonious aspects, such as trines and sextiles, suggest areas of ease and compatibility. Challenging aspects, like squares and oppositions, can point to potential friction but also opportunities for growth and development. The placement of planets in each other’s houses is also significant. For instance, if one person’s Sun falls in the other person’s 7th house of partnerships, it can signify a strong focus on the relationship and mutual understanding.
